When Eric Clapton walked onstage at Winterland on March 10, 1968 with his fellow Cream band mates, I am sure he didn’t realize how much that one performance would become one of his most defining moments. Eric Clapton’s scorching live version of Robert Johnson’s blues classic “Crossroads” was the highlight of the show. The solos Eric Clapton plays in Cream’s “Crossroads” are recognized as some of the greatest ever played, no small feat for a live performance. In this video guitar lesson series you will learn “Crossroads” by Cream note-for-note. All of the rhythms and solos are broken down in a step-by-step and easy to follow format.
